The hexadecimal color code #774CE8 corresponds to the code RGB( 119, 76, 232 ). It's a shade of Blue. This color is a combination of red (at 0,47 level), green (at 0,30 level) and blue (at 0,91 level). Its brightness is 60% and its saturation is 77%. It is composed of red at 27%, green at 17% and blue at 54%.
